Dos de Mayo
Dos de Mayo is a hamlet in Ihuari District, Huaral Province, Lima region and has about 96 residents and an elevation of 2,734 metres. Dos de Mayo is situated nearby to the hamlet Llocyatama, as well as near Chiguil.- Type: Hamlet with 96 residents
